> Isn't there a technote on the subject? Yeah, #026 is a Rom revision
> summary.
But not the subject of discussion here - this technotes covers the
changes between ROM 00 and ROM 01 (which it confusingly calls "ROM 1"
and "ROM 2").
Apple didn't publish a technical note explaining the differences between
the original Apple IIgs and the "Apple IIgs with 1 megabyte of RAM"
(a.k.a. "ROM 3").
